Q: A company is facing high employee turnover. Which management principle should be prioritized to address this issue?
Solution: Stability of tenure is crucial for reducing turnover and fostering a committed workforce.
Steps: 6
Step 1: Understand what employee turnover means. It refers to the rate at which employees leave a company and need to be replaced.
Step 2: Recognize that high turnover can be costly and disruptive for a company.
Step 3: Identify the management principle of 'stability of tenure.' This means keeping employees in their jobs for a longer time.
Step 4: Realize that when employees stay longer, they become more experienced and committed to the company.
Step 5: Focus on creating a work environment that encourages employees to stay, such as offering good benefits, career development, and a positive workplace culture.
Step 6: Implement strategies to improve job satisfaction and employee engagement to reduce turnover.
